// GC_PAUSE_BUDGET_MS caps acceptable garbage-collection pause time in the
// Lockstep matching service. Matches are re-validated after any pause that
// exceeds this budget, since a long stall can let a stale candidate slip
// past the freshness check. Security note: this is a correctness guard,
// not a rate limiter; do not repurpose it for throttling. The value was
// tuned from pause histograms collected on the build recorded below.

pipeline stamp: htk9_ce63042d9

Handover note — Crumbwheel order cutoffs.

Welcome aboard. The bakery cutoff rule in Crumbwheel closes same-day orders at 14:00 local to each storefront, not UTC — this has bitten us twice. Holiday overrides live in the calendar service and take precedence silently, so always check there first when a cutoff looks wrong. To unlock the calendar service's admin console after a restart, enter the recovery passphrase below.

vault phrase of bagap-bahaf = silion-pelox-sorox-casdor-quenwyn-fraax-eliox-praael-kelion-quenvan-kasox-rusael-norius-belvan

Capacity note for the Bramblewick export retry queue. Failed exports are requeued with exponential backoff, and the queue depth is our main capacity signal: sustained depth above the high-water mark means downstream Pellis storage is saturated, not that we need more workers. As the new contractor, please don't raise worker counts without checking storage latency first — it usually makes things worse. Retry timing, backoff caps, and the high-water threshold are all driven by the constants shown below.

limits module of yagef-bajog:
TIERS = {
    "druael": 370,
    "tamix": 286,
    "pelius": 541,
    "pelael": 78,
    "pelox": 47,
    "ralath": 533,
    "drumir": 801,
}